What is a 2002 Tundra Wiring Diagram and How is it Used?

A 2002 Tundra wiring diagram is essentially a visual representation of all the electrical circuits within your second-generation Toyota Tundra. It shows how power flows from the battery to various components like the headlights, radio, engine control module, and everything in between. These diagrams are meticulously created by automotive engineers to detail the exact location, color, and function of each wire and connection. Understanding the 2002 Tundra wiring diagram is crucial for accurate diagnosis and repair of electrical problems. Without it, you'd be navigating a maze of wires blindfolded.

The primary use of a 2002 Tundra wiring diagram is for troubleshooting and repair. When a particular electrical component isn't working, the diagram allows you to trace the circuit from the power source to the faulty part. This helps identify potential issues such as:

  • Blown fuses
  • Bad relays
  • Damaged wiring
  • Defective switches or sensors

Beyond repairs, a 2002 Tundra wiring diagram is also useful for modifications or additions. If you're looking to install an aftermarket stereo, auxiliary lights, or even a remote starter, the diagram provides the necessary information to tap into the existing circuits correctly without causing damage. It’s also a great tool for understanding how different systems interact.

To effectively use a 2002 Tundra wiring diagram, you'll need to familiarize yourself with the symbols and legends that represent different electrical components and connections. These diagrams are typically organized by system, making it easier to find the specific circuit you need to inspect. For example, you might find separate sections for the lighting system, the engine management system, or the interior accessories. Following the lines that represent wires allows you to track the path of electricity and identify potential break points or shorts.
